No matter the date on the calendar, when you walk inside Robert Moore & Co., it feels like December 25. The store has been part of the Mobile community for nearly 50 years, and they love celebrating Christmas all year round.
It’s not in anyone’s plans to spend Christmas in a hospital, but sometimes that is reality. Thankfully, for patients at Children’s of Alabama, the staff works extremely hard to make sure it’s still a special holiday, and that task is made easier thanks to generous donors including this year’s participants in the Youth Leadership Conference.
One poinsettia brings enough Christmas cheer that it can be the only decoration in a room. So the greenhouses in Dixie Green can make a Grinch’s heart grow four sizes and turn an Ebenezer Scrooge into a holiday hero. Growing more than 150,000 poinsettias, Dixie Green turns Cherokee County into Christmas central every fall.
